What Is a Sensitive Stomach in Dogs?

A sensitive stomach in dogs means their digestive system gets upset easily. Common signs include:

  • Vomiting or regurgitation
  • Diarrhea or loose stools
  • Gas or bloating
  • Refusing to eat
  • Acting restless or uncomfortable after meals

These issues can stem from food allergies, low-quality ingredients, or even stress. For example, my neighbor’s Labrador, Max, used to vomit after eating kibble with artificial additives. Switching to a raw diet made a huge difference! If your dog shows these symptoms, check with your vet to rule out medical issues like parasites or pancreatitis before changing their diet.

Key Features of the Best Raw Dog Food for Sensitive Stomachs

Not all raw dog foods are created equal. When choosing the best raw dog food for a sensitive stomach, look for these features:

1. Limited Ingredients

Limited-ingredient diets reduce the chance of triggering allergies. Look for recipes with one or two protein sources, like turkey or fish, and minimal veggies.

2. Lean Proteins

Proteins like turkey, chicken, or white fish are easier to digest than fatty meats like beef. For example, turkey is low in fat and gentle on the stomach.

3. No Grains or Fillers

Grains like wheat or corn can cause inflammation in sensitive dogs. Grain-free raw food is often a safer bet.

4. Added Digestive Support

Some raw foods include prebiotics, probiotics, or fiber-rich ingredients like pumpkin to boost gut health.

5. High-Quality Sourcing

Choose brands that use human-grade or ethically sourced ingredients to avoid contaminants that could worsen sensitivities.

Tips for Transitioning to a Raw Diet

Switching your dog to raw food too quickly can upset their stomach even more. Follow these steps for a smooth transition:

  1. Go Slow: Start with 10-20% raw food mixed with their current food. Gradually increase the raw portion over 10-14 days.
  2. Monitor Symptoms: Watch for changes in stool, energy, or appetite. If issues persist, slow down or consult your vet.
  3. Add Supplements: Bone broth or probiotics can ease the transition and support digestion.
  4. Stay Consistent: Once you find a raw food that works, stick with it to avoid upsetting your dog’s stomach.
